Course Description
The adage 'you can't improve what you don't measure' has been used across many business functions. Often, the accounts payable function is not included as it is difficult to measure with any precision. However, any company that wants its accounts payable department to improve must be able to measure its performance against its peers.
This course will examine the reasons for benchmarking in accounts payable, how to get started, and how to use the results to drive efficiency in your accounts payable process. Some common metrics will be discussed and evaluated. Data from recent AP Now surveys on invoices and payments will be included to demonstrate how your organization measures up to others. This course also covers the common mistakes companies make when benchmarking their accounts payable process.
